    Weight is not everything- it all depends on theright body analyses

    In the past, a person’s absolu-te weight was the determiningfactor for evaluatingone’s body. But today, weknow that it’s all about the"composition". Evolution for-med mankind as a living creature, which had to be veryactive while sustaining itselfon a sparse diet."Modern" men and women,however, do the exact opposi-te: Sparse activity and a plen-tiful diet, often a "bad” diet.The consequences are knownto all of us. Many diseases ofcivilization could be avoided ifonly we could program oursel-ves to maintain a healthy life-style.

    Usually, we weigh too muchbecause we have too muchbody fat! This means: If youwant to loose weight, increaseyour muscle mass. Duringtimes when food is sparse (= diet), the human bodyreacts with an "emergencyprogram":Before using up its fat reserves, it uses muscle mass.And vice versa, when normalnutrition is resumed, it firstadds further fat reserves,which results in the much feared "yoyo" effect.With simultaneous muscleand fitness training you willbe able to balance yourweight, body fat and musclemass.

    Proportion of Body Fat

    Whilst the proportion of bodyfat in % is shown in thedisplay, one of the 9 seg-ments appears in the barbelow it. Too much body fatis unhealthy and does notlook nice. What is moreimportant is that a high proportion of body fat is alsousually associated with a raised proportion of fat in theblood and this increases greatly the risk of various ill-nesses such as for instancediabetes, heart disease, highblood pressure etc. But a verylow proportion of body fat isequally unhealthy.Apart from the fatty tissueunder the skin, the body alsostores important fat depositsfor the protection of the inter-nal organs and to ensureimportant metabolic func-tions. If this essential fatreserve is compromised, thiscan lead to metabolic distur-bance.So for instance in womenwith body fat figures ofunder 10%, menstruationmay cease. In addition, therisk of osteoporosis increases.The normal proportion ofbody fat is dependent on ageand above all on sex. In women the normal figureis about 10% higher than inmen. With increasing age thebody loses muscle mass andso the proportion of body fatincreases.

    Proportion of BodyWater

    Whilst the proportion of waterin the body in % is shown inthe display, one of the 9 seg-ments appears in the barbelow it.

    The figure shown in this ana-lysis reflects the "total bodywater” (TBW). The body of anadult is composed of about60% water. Here there is ofcourse a certain range, witholder people showing a lowerproportion of water thanyounger people and men sho-wing a higher proportion thanwomen.

    The distinction between menand women is a result of thehigher mass of body fat inwomen. Since the majority ofthe body’s water is to befound in the fat-free mass(73% of the FFM is water)and since the water contentin the fat is very low by itsnature (about10% of thefatty tissue is water), the proportion of body fat auto-matically decreases with anincreasing proportion of waterin the body.

    Analysis is based on the mea-surement of the body's elect-rical resistance. Eating anddrinking habits during thecourse of the day and indivi-dual lifestyle affect the waterbalance. This is noticeable bythe fluctuations in the dis-play.

    In order to ensure that theresults of analysis are a accu-rate and consistent as possi-ble, keep the measurementconditions constant, as onlyin this way will you be able toobserve changes over anextended period.

    Other factors can affect waterbalance:

    After a bath, the body fat rea-ding may be too low and thebody water reading too high.

    After a meal, readings can behigher.

    Women may experiencefluctuations due to the mens-trual cycle.

    Due to loss of water causedby illness or after physicalactivity (sport). After takingexercise, wait for 6 to 8 hoursbefore carrying out the nextmeasurement.

    Varying or implausible resultscan occur in the case of:

    Persons with a high tempera-ture, symptoms of oedema orosteoporosis.

    Persons undergoing dialysistreatment.

    Persons taking cardiovascularmedicine.

    Pregnant women.

    If the analysis is performedwhile wearing wet socks.
